So Hooya is one of those apps where you can video chat with random people from everywhere, but it tries to keep things feeling pretty chill and straightforward. You open it up and you can either connect through video right away or just send a text if you’re not in the mood to be on camera. The video quality is actually decent, which helps—faces come in really clear and you’re not stuck trying to make out blurry pixels or anything.
People on there can add a little polish using the beauty filters, which honestly makes things less awkward if you feel a bit camera-shy. If you ever get into a weird chat or just aren’t feeling a convo, leaving is really easy with just a single tap. What stands out is that you can check out profiles before jumping into a call, so you’re not totally going in blind every time. There’s a moderation team around, too, so it feels a bit more relaxed—you’re able to report or block anyone who acts out. On PC, especially with BlueStacks, it feels kind of freeing to step away from the tiny phone screen and just meet people on a bigger display.
